/**
* This team implements the UI for a StopWatch and contains the role class
* WatchDisplay.
*/
public team class WatchUIAnalog {
public class WatchDisplay extends JFrame playedBy StopWatch {
AnalogClock clockFace;
private JButton startButton;
private JButton stopButton;
private JButton clearButton;
//========================================================== constructor
public WatchDisplay(StopWatch sw) {
Container content = this.getContentPane();
content.setLayout(new BorderLayout());
clockFace = new AnalogClock();
this.setLocation(90, 110);
this.setResizable(false);
content.add(clockFace, BorderLayout.CENTER);
JPanel buttons = new JPanel();
buttons.setLayout(new FlowLayout());
startButton = new JButton("start");
startButton.addActionListener(new ActionListener() {
public void actionPerformed(ActionEvent e) {
start();
}});
buttons.add(startButton);
stopButton = new JButton("stop");
stopButton.addActionListener(new ActionListener() {
public void actionPerformed(ActionEvent e) {
stop();
}});
buttons.add(stopButton);
clearButton = new JButton("clear");
clearButton.addActionListener(new ActionListener() {
public void actionPerformed(ActionEvent e) {
clear();
}});
buttons.add(clearButton);
content.add(buttons, BorderLayout.SOUTH);
this.setTitle("Analog Stop Watch");
this.setSize(new Dimension(298, 440));
setDefaultCloseOperation(JFrame.DISPOSE_ON_CLOSE);
setVisible(true);
}//end constructor
void update() {
clockFace.update(getValue());
}
// Abstract methods for mapping to the concrete base methods:
abstract void stop();
abstract void clear();
abstract int getValue();
// callout method bindings: any call of the abstract WatchDisplay
// method will be forwarded to the concrete StopWatch method
void start() -> void start();
stop -> stop;
clear -> reset;
getValue -> getValue;
// Callin method bindings: WatchDisplay (role object) is updated
// after the StopWatch (base object) advanced or was reset.
void update() <- after void advance();
void update() <- after void reset();
}//end class ClockAnalogBuf
/**
* The team constructor uses declared lifting. A WatchDisplay role is
* created for the given StopWatch object.
*/
public WatchUIAnalog (StopWatch as WatchDisplay w) {
activate(ALL_THREADS); // Without this, the callin bindings have no effect.
}
}
